A pilot in a plane at an altitude of 22,000 feet observes that the angle of depression to a nearby airport is 26 degrees. How many miles is the airport from a point on the ground directly below the plane?
Answers
Answered by
Damon
tan 26 = (22,000/d)
d tan 26 = 22,000
d = 22,000 / tan 26 = 45,107
